Average Project Costs for Maple Valley Backyard Makeovers
Reviewing average project costs helps you set a flexible budget for your front and backyard design. In Maple Valley, homeowners typically spend between $5,000–$20,000 for mid-range outdoor living spaces—depending on materials, size, and whether you include features like outdoor fire features or deck and patio builders’ work.
For transparency, request itemized quotes that break down labor, materials, and design time from multiple landscape architects near me.

Red Flags to Watch For in Landscaping Bids
Recognizing red flags in landscaping bids can prevent costly mistakes. Be cautious of unrealistically discounted quotes, contractors who demand no contract, or those who lack references or portfolio work.
- Steer clear bids missing warranties
